## About

Aberforth Partners LLP is an investment management firm established in 1990, wholly owned by its full time working partners. The firm focuses exclusively on small UK quoted companies and is committed to value investment. It manages several trusts and funds, including the Aberforth Smaller Companies Trust plc and the Aberforth UK Small Companies Fund.

## Questions

### Does Aberforth invest in private companies, or only public equities?

Aberforth invests exclusively in publicly listed UK equities, focusing on the smaller-company segment. The closed-end fund structure permits holding illiquid smaller-cap names without redemption-driven forced selling, but the firm does not make direct private equity investments, venture deals, or pre-IPO placements.

### What does Aberforth explicitly avoid?

The firm avoids companies with excessive leverage, binary-outcome biotechnology, speculative resource exploration, and momentum-driven growth stocks where valuation multiples decouple from tangible asset backing. Investment trusts do not use derivatives for speculation; gearing is used conservatively within the closed-end structure.

### Why is Aberforth headquartered in Edinburgh rather than London?

Edinburgh has been the partnership's home since its 1990 founding, a deliberate choice that distances the investment team from the daily noise of the City of London. The firm maintains a small London office for client and corporate access, but portfolio construction, research, and partnership governance all sit in Edinburgh — reinforcing the long-cycle, low-turnover philosophy.

### How does Aberforth source investment ideas?

The partnership relies on a proprietary screening process that flags UK-listed companies trading below their estimated intrinsic worth, combined with direct management meetings. Because the firm has covered the UK smaller-company universe for over three decades, many position initiations come from re-visiting businesses the team has tracked through multiple cycles, rather than reacting to broker-initiated coverage.
